Potential Inverse Head-and-Shoulders Pattern Forming

The chart suggests SPX6900 may be forming an inverse head-and-shoulders pattern, a bullish reversal structure indicating trend exhaustion. The left shoulder, head, and right shoulder are clearly outlined, but the pattern is still incomplete. For the pattern to remain valid, the critical support at $0.58 must hold; breaking this level would invalidate the setup.

If buyers defend $0.58 and the right shoulder completes, the price must rise and close above the neckline at $0.73–$0.75 to confirm a breakout. A successful breakout signals strengthening momentum and triggers the measured-move target based on the distance between the head and neckline. This move typically leads to accelerated upside continuation, supported by the bullish dotted projection on the chart.

Once confirmed, the inverse head-and-shoulders pattern forms several projections targeting the upside: a conservative target of $0.82, a mid-range target of $0.95, as well as a full measure move targeting between $1.00 and $1.10. These correspond with the chart’s outlined course. However, if the closing value goes below $0.58, all previous bullish projections will expire, and new support levels will come into play.

Technical Indicators Show Early Momentum Shift

The value of the RSI for SPX6900 shows that it remains in the mid-40s, moving towards a recovery position from its downtrend. Although it is still below the value of 50, its positive movement shows that the rate of selling is slowing down. This shift indicates early momentum rebuilding as buyers begin to regain control.

But the MACD is still in a bearish zone with the MACD line below the zero line as well as the signal line. However, the minimizing bar in the histogram indicates diminishing bears. Although a bullish cross is not seen, this is often likely to precede a likely reversal, implying that the SPX will prepare for some further rises.

The short-term Elliott Wave outlook for the Nasdaq 100 ETF (QQQ) indicates that the cycle from the April 2025 low remains active. Wave (4) of the ongoing impulse concluded at 580.27, and the ETF has since resumed its upward trajectory. To confirm continuation, price must break above the prior wave (3) peak recorded on 30 October at 638.41. The rally from the 21 November wave (4) low has matured and is expected to complete soon, reflecting the natural rhythm of the Elliott Wave sequence. The advance from wave (4) has unfolded as a five-wave impulse. Within this structure, wave ((i)) ended at 586.25, followed by a corrective pullback in wave ((ii)) that terminated at 580.36. From there, the ETF nested higher. Wave (i) of the next sequence ended at 596.98, while wave (ii) pulled back to 589.44. Momentum carried wave (iii) to 606.76, before wave (iv) corrected to 597.32. The final leg, wave (v), reached 619.51, completing wave ((iii)) at a higher degree. A subsequent pullback in wave ((iv)) ended at 612.13. Looking ahead, wave ((v)) of 1 is expected to finish soon. Afterward, a corrective wave 2 should unfold, addressing the cycle from the 21 November low before the ETF resumes higher. In the near term, as long as the pivot at 580.27 remains intact, dips are anticipated to find support in a 3, 7, or 11 swing sequence, reinforcing prospects for further upside.
